There are three areas in the Greater Augusta area where ongoing work may cause delays this weekend.
– Route 629 (Deerfield Valley Road) – Road work continues because of a rock slide that closed the road between Route 250 and Route 716 (West Augusta Road). Use Route 716 to connect to Route 250 and Route 629.
– Route 774 (Cline River Road, New Hope) – Work to replace a bridge over Middle River has closed Route 774 northbound and southbound between Route 608 (Battlefield Road) and Route 775 (Craig Shop Road) in Augusta County. Suggested detour: Northbound traffic take Route 608 to Route 778 (Knightly Mill Road) to Route 775 to Route 774. Southbound traffic take reverse of northbound detour.
– Route 794 (Sangers Lane) – Work to replace a bridge over Christians Creek has closed Route 794 eastbound and westbound between Route 792 (Basley Road) and Route 642 (Barren Ridge Road) in Augusta County. Suggested detour: Westbound traffic take Route 792 south to Route 250 (Jefferson Highway) east to Route 642 north to Route 794. Eastbound traffic take reverse of westbound detour.
